Sae (written: 紗英, 紗江, 佐江, 沙恵, 三重, 彩恵, さえ in hiragana or サエ in katakana) is a feminine Japanese given name. Notable people with the name include:
- Sae Isshiki (一色 紗英, born 1977), Japanese actress
 - Sae Itō (伊藤 沙恵, born 1993), Japanese shogi player
 - Sae Miyakawa (宮川 紗江, born 1999), Japanese artistic gymnast
 - Sae Miyazawa (宮澤 佐江, born 1990), Japanese singer and actress
 - Sae Murase (村瀬 紗英, born 1997), Japanese singer
 - Sae Nakazawa (中澤 さえ, born 1983), Japanese judoka
 - Sae Tachikawa (立川 サエ, 1889–1990), Japanese educator
 - Sae Watanabe (渡辺 三重, born 1968), Japanese gymnast
 - Sae Yamamoto (curler) (山本 冴, born 2001), Japanese curler
